One of the most popular types of india boxes is the jewelry box. These boxes are often made of wood and embellished with intricate carvings, colorful beads, and mirrors. The designs on these boxes often reflect traditional Indian motifs such as paisley, peacocks, and floral patterns. Some jewelry boxes are also adorned with semi-precious stones like turquoise, lapis lazuli, and coral to add a touch of luxury.
India boxes are not just limited to storing jewelry. They are also used to store spices, herbs, and other culinary items. These spice boxes, also known as masala dabba, are typically made of stainless steel and feature multiple compartments to store a variety of spices. Each spice box is a symbol of Indian culinary tradition and is often passed down from generation to generation.
